WebA small portion of the water is evaporated which removes the heat from the remaining water. The warm moist air is forced to the top of the cooling tower by the fan and discharged to the atmosphere. Product Brochure. piscataway rental apartmentsWebA forced draft tower is similar to an induced draft tower, but the placement of its fans is different. A forced draft tower typically has fans located in the air intake rather than the air outlet. These fans, located on the sides or at the base of the tower, push air directly into the tower instead of pulling it. piscataway restaurantsWebThe below video is an extract from our Introduction to Cooling Towers Online Video Course.
